Full-Stack Engineer (Senior)

Location: Toronto, ON, Canada (Remote, Greater Toronto and Hamilton Area only)

Employment Type: Full-Time

Seniority Level: Senior. 7+ years of professional full-stack development experience required.


About TurboVets

TurboVets modernizes the entire military lifecycle, from service to civilian success, in one unified platform. Built by veterans and technologists with firsthand experience navigating military systems, we support veterans, active service members, military recruits, and individuals transitioning into civilian life. We value honesty, autonomy, and collaboration, and build scalable systems that solve real problems and have measurable impact.


The Role

We're looking for a Full-Stack Engineer who takes ownership end-to-end, from system design through deployment. You'll turn real-world operational needs, often from military and government stakeholders, into secure, scalable, reliable software that replaces legacy platforms and modernizes how critical services are delivered. Your code runs in mission-critical environments where quality, security, and performance are non-negotiable.


This is a senior role with real influence: you'll collaborate closely with product, design, and engineering to ship features that matter, not tickets that disappear into a backlog. You'll work on products spanning career development, financial wellness, secure records, and the modernization of legacy government systems.


Tech Stack

Angular, TypeScript, Tailwind CSS · NestJS, Node.js, Apollo GraphQL, REST APIs · PostgreSQL · Docker, Kubernetes, GitHub Actions · OAuth 2.0, JWT, SSO, RBAC · Redis


What You'll Own

Backend:

  • Architect and develop scalable backend services using NestJS, Node.js, and TypeScript
  • Design and maintain GraphQL (Apollo Federation) and REST APIs
  • Model and optimize relational databases
  • Implement authentication, authorization, and RBAC patterns
  • Build microservices and event-driven systems using Redis and related tooling
  • Collaborate with DevOps on CI/CD, containerization, and infrastructure decisions


Frontend:

  • Build responsive, accessible UIs using Angular (or equivalent frameworks)
  • Translate product and design requirements into maintainable client-side architecture
  • Manage complex state using RxJS, Angular Signals, or similar patterns
  • Optimize performance and ensure usability across devices


Cross-Functional:

  • Own features from planning through production
  • Collaborate with designers, product managers, and stakeholders
  • Review code, mentor engineers, and influence technical direction
  • Write and maintain documentation for APIs, architecture, and internal tooling
  • Implement and maintain unit and integration tests


What We're Looking For

Required:

  • 7+ years of professional full-stack development experience
  • 3+ years working with NestJS, TypeScript, and GraphQL
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or equivalent experience
  • Strong database design and query optimization skills (PostgreSQL preferred)
  • Production experience with Angular, React, or comparable frontend frameworks
  • Experience with Docker, Kubernetes, and CI/CD pipelines
  • Strong communication skills and comfort working autonomously in a remote environment


Bonus:

  • Experience with monorepo architectures (Nx or similar)
  • gRPC, WebSockets
  • Serverless platforms (AWS Lambda, Azure Functions)
  • CQRS, DDD, or event-sourced systems
  • Observability and performance tooling (Prometheus, Grafana, load testing, rate limiting)


Who You Are

  • You take ownership without waiting to be asked, and you're comfortable making the call when the path forward isn't obvious.
  • You communicate clearly with engineers and non-technical stakeholders alike, and you don't let technical decisions get buried in jargon.
  • You care about the mission. Building tools that make a real difference for veterans and service members isn't just a footnote to you.


Location & Compensation

Remote, based in the Greater Toronto and Hamilton Area (GTHA). Legal entitlement to work in Canada required. TurboVets is currently fully remote in Canada, with a Toronto-area office planned next year.


Salary: $140,000–$170,000 CAD, based on experience, plus equity, flexible work policies, and extended health benefits (dental, vision, and more).
